Fog is measured where instruments live — airports. Hours/yr = time below CAT I approach minima (visibility under ~½ mile or ceiling under 200 ft), the aviation definition of seriously dense fog.

When Périgueux/Bassillac fogs in

Fog here concentrates in November and December — about 363 hours in a typical year at LFBX, usually lasting ~2 h once it forms. Hour-by-hour patterns, live conditions and the forecast strip live on the LFBX station page.

Fog season

January: ~37 hJanFebruary: ~33 hFebMarch: ~17 hMarApril: ~14 hAprMay: ~15 hMayJune: ~13 hJunJuly: ~6 hJulAugust: ~10 hAugSeptember: ~30 hSepOctober: ~57 hOctNovember: ~67 hNovDecember: ~68 hDec
Fog season runs September through March, peaking in December; fog is mostly a 11 PM–9 AM phenomenon; typically thinning out by 11 AM; a typical event lasts about 2 hours once it forms local time · 10-yr average
